自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(164)
  • 收藏
  • 关注

转载 搭建MySQL高可用负载均衡集群

阅读目录1、简介2、基本环境3、配置MySQL主主复制4、中间件简述  4.1、Haproxy介绍  4.2、keepalived介绍5、中间件的安装与配置(haproxy、keepalived)  5.1、安装haproxy  1)、编译安装haproxy  2)、提供启动脚本  3)、提供配置文件  4)、启动日志  5)、启动haproxy  6)、测试haproxy  5.2、安...

2017-12-29 17:59:00 98

转载 MySQL——修改root密码的4种方法(以windows为例)

方法1: 用SET PASSWORD命令 首先登录MySQL。 格式:mysql> set password for 用户名@localhost = password('新密码'); 例子:mysql> set password for root@localhost = password('123'); 方法2:用mysqladmin 格式:mysqladmin -u用户名...

2017-12-29 17:37:00 69

转载 浅谈mysql集群

一、什么是MySQL集群 MySQL集群是一个无共享的(shared-nothing)、分布式节点架构的存储方案,其目的是提供容错性和高性能。 数据更新使用读已提交隔离级别(read-committedisolation)来保证所有节点数据的一致性,使用两阶段提交机制(two-phasedcommit)保证所有节点都有相同...

2017-12-29 17:27:00 78

转载 安装Mysql最新版本mysql-5.7.10-winx64出现的几个问题解决

电脑是64位的安装不了Windows (x86, 32-bit),Mysql installer MSI ,然后下载了Windows (x86, 32-bit), ZIP Archive 这种是免安装直接解压使用的,因为最新版本的原因也有一些问题。(1) 首先解压后有一个默认的配置文件my-default.ini配...

2017-12-29 16:20:00 144

转载 MySQL各个版本的区别

文章出自:http://blog.sina.com.cn/s/blog_62b37bfe0101he5t.html感谢作者的分享MySQL 的官网下载地址:http://www.mysql.com/downloads/在这个下载界面会有几个版本的选择。1. MySQL Community Server 社区版本,...

2017-12-29 16:12:00 66

转载 手把手教你用Mysql-Cluster-7.5搭建数据库集群

阅读目录前言mysql cluster中的几个概念解释架构图及说明下载mysql cluster安装mysql cluster之前安装配置管理节点安装配置数据和mysql节点测试启动和关闭总结前言当你的业务到达一定的当量,肯定需要一定数量的数据库来负载均衡你的数据库请求,我在之前的博客中已经说明了,如何实现负载均衡,但是还有一个问题就是数据同步,因为负载均衡的前提就是,各个服务器的数据...

2017-12-29 15:59:00 109

转载 MySQL集群---②Windows平台搭建MySQL CLUSTER集群

本文将通过两台电脑来简单介绍一下Windows平台如何搭建MySQL集群。 MySQL集群支持多台电脑,本文搭建的MySQL集群以两台机子为例,其中一台(IP为192.168.24.33)部署管理节点、数据节点和SQL节点,另一台(IP为192.168.24.82)部署数据节点和SQL节点。 实际应用中,不要将管理节...

2017-12-29 15:54:00 72

转载 mysql集群搭建教程-基础篇

计算机一级考试系统要用集群,目标是把集群搭建起来,保证一个库dang了,不会影响程序的运行。于是在孟海滨师哥的带领下开始了我的第一次搭建mysql集群,首先看了一些关于集群的资料,然后根据步骤一步步的整,遇到了一些问题,在这里把我遇到的问题以及解决方法分享出来。【是什么】 集群(cluster)技术是一种...

2017-12-29 15:53:00 113

转载 Mysql多实例的配置和管理

多实例mysql的安装和管理mysql的多实例有两种方式可以实现,两种方式各有利弊。第一种是使用多个配置文件启动不同的进程来实现多实例,这种方式的优势逻辑简单,配置简单,缺点是管理起来不太方便。第二种是通过官方自带的mysqld_multi使用单独的配置文件来实现多实例,这种方式定制每个实例的配置不太方面,优点是管理起来很方便,集中管理。下面就分别来实战这两种多实例的安装和管理先...

2017-12-29 15:31:00 77

转载 MySQL 使用mysqld_multi部署单机多实例详细过程

序言:多实例?Why?随着硬件层面的发展,linux系统多核已经是普通趋势,而mysql是单进程多线程,所以先天上对多进程的利用不是很高,虽然5.6版本已经在这方面改进很多,但是也没有达到100%,所以为了充分的利用系统资源,mysql有自己的补充,那就是可以部署多实例,一个实例一个端口。1,准备好mysql环境源码安装mysql参...

2017-12-29 15:29:00 85

转载 [MySQL 5.1 体验]MySQL 实例管理器 mysqlmanager 初试

原贴:http://imysql.cn/node/313[MySQL 5.1 体验]MySQL 实例管理器 mysqlmanager 初试 周二, 2007/06/19 - 22:10 — yejr作/译者:叶金荣(imysql#imysql.com>),来源:http://imysql.com,欢迎转载。作...

2017-12-29 15:28:00 165

转载 MYSQLMANAGER实例管理器总结

好久没有写文章了,今天来看看MYSQL的实例管理器(MYSQLMANAGER)。一、简单介绍:1、MySQL实例管理器(IM)是通过TCP/IP端口运行的后台程序,用来监视和管理MySQL数据库服务器实例。(如果你之前用过MYSQLD_MULTI就很清楚了。)2、如果IM挂了,则所有的实例就挂掉了;如果实例挂了,IM会尝试重新启动它。3、...

2017-12-29 15:26:00 295

转载 mysql系列之多实例介绍

介绍:mysql多实例,简单理解就是在一台服务器上,mysql服务开启多个不同的端口(如3306、3307),运行多个服务进程。这些 mysql 服务进程通过不同的 socket来监听不同的数据端口,进而互不干涉的提供各自的服务。在同一台服务器上,mysql 多实例会去共用一套 mysql 应用程序,因此你在部署 mysql 的时候只需要部署一次 mysql程序即可,无需多次部署。...

2017-12-29 15:15:00 90

转载 MySQL 5.7 多实例安装部署实例

1. 背景 MySQL数据库的集中化运维,可以通过在一台服务器上,部署运行多个MySQL服务进程,通过不同的socket监听不同的服务端口来提供各自的服务。各个实例之间是相互独立的,每个实例的datadir, port, socket, pid都是不同的。2. 多实例特点 * 有效利用服务器资源,当单个服务器资源有剩余时,可以充分利用剩余的资源提供更多的服务。 * 资源互相...

2017-12-29 15:14:00 161

转载 Mysql多实例安装+主从复制+读写分离 -学习笔记

Mysql多实例安装+主从复制+读写分离 -学习笔记 .embody{ padding:1...

2017-12-29 15:02:00 111

转载 mysql-5.7.19-winx64服务无法启动解决方案

解压mysql压缩包时没有data文件夹,不要手动创建,在cmd下直接运行命令: mysqld –initialize-insecure,data文件夹会自动生成,注意单词千万不要拼错,不要写成–initialise,也不要只写–initialize,如果不输入-insecu...

2017-12-29 13:37:00 117

转载 MySQL集群搭建详解

概述MySQL Cluster 是MySQL 适合于分布式计算环境的高实用、可拓展、高性能、高冗余版本,其研发设计的初衷就是要满足许多行业里的最严酷应用要求,这些应用中经常要求数据库运行的可靠性要达到99.999%。MySQL Cluster允许在无共享的系统中部署“内存中”数据库集群,通过无共享体系结构,系统能够使用廉价的硬件,而且对软硬件无特殊要求。此外,由于每个组件有自己的内存...

2017-12-29 12:01:00 68

转载 Windows下多个Mysql实例配置主从

序: 网上有很多类似的文章,也是各种百度出来的,但是对于多数刚开始接触MYSQL主从的小白来说,网上文章的代码里面很多技术点都没有理解,有跌打误撞碰上的,但多数都是这篇文章卡主了,换篇文章接着卡。- -。 下面真正开始写教程之前,我希望你能够先完整的看完,再去敲代码。 方法适用于MYSQL 5.1之后的版本。之前...

2017-12-29 11:45:00 58

转载 在一台机子上,安装,运行两mysql数据库实例

为了方便测试,想要用到两个mysql数据库实例。以windows系统为例 当然安装第一个mysql数据库,很简单没什么说的。但是再要安装,运行mysql安装程序时,会提示,修复,卸载,重新安装。这时需要下载一个免安装的mysql,zip文件的。到点击打开链接选择,ZIP Archive格式的下载,根据系统选择32,64位...

2017-12-29 11:44:00 87

转载 Windows下MySQL多实例运行(转)

关键字:Windows下MySQL多实例运行阅读前注意事项:1、有的版本的data目录不直接放在mysql安装目录下,有可能在:C:\ProgramData\MySQL\MySQL Server 5.1\data(不管路径在哪里 指定正确的路径即可)2、操作步骤:复制MySQL安装目录-->修改my.ini中的端口2处、安装目录和数据目录---->命令安装M...

2017-12-29 11:34:00 60

转载 mysql 多实例案例实战

其实Mysql多实例就是在一个 mysql 服务上面启动三个实例,相当于三个分离开来的数据库,至于为什么要做这个,你也可以选择分别安装三个MySQL,只是过于麻烦,多实例中只需要一个配置档my.cnf,并且通过mysql_330x.sock 便于管理数据库。其实MySQL多实例...

2017-12-29 11:24:00 73

转载 Windows(x86,64bit)升级MySQL 5.7.17免安装版的详细教程

MySQL需要升级到5.5.3以上版本才支持Laravel 5.4默认的utf8mb64字符编码。因此就把MySQL升级了一下,期间还是遇到些小问题,记录一下以供参考。升级准备 备份之前MySql目录下的data目录(数据库目录)。 MySql官网下载MySQL 5.7.17版本压缩包。 管理员身份运行命令行,输入net stop mysql命令,停止mysql服务。...

2017-12-28 17:40:00 131

转载 如何在同一台机器上安装多个MySQL的实例(转)

  最近由于工作的需要,需要在同一台机器上搭建两个MySQL的实例,(注:已经存在了一个3306的MySQL的实例)。  先说下,什么是mysql的多实例,简单的来说就是一台机器上安装了多个mysql的服务,通过不同的端口(如3307,3308)来向外界提供服务,这些进程通过不同的socket来监听不同的服务端口来提供个字的服务。  做个比喻:MySQL的多实例相当于房子的相当于多个...

2017-12-28 17:31:00 67

转载 Windows上安装多个MySQL实例(转)

在学习和开发过程中有时候会用到多个MySQL数据库,比如Master-Slave集群、分库分表,开发阶段在一台机器上安装多个MySQL实例就显得方便不少。在 MySQL教程-基础篇-1.1-Windows上安装MySQL 章节有详细讲解在Windows上用压缩包安装MySQL服...

2017-12-28 17:30:00 85

转载 spring+mybatis+Atomikos JTA事务配置说明

一、概览Atomikos是一个公司名字,旗下最著名的莫过于其Atomikos的事务管理器产品。产品分两个:一个是开源的TransactionEssentials,一个是商业的ExtremeTransactions。TransactionEssentials的主要特征:JTA/XA 事务管理 —— 提供事务管理和连接池不需要应用...

2017-12-28 17:27:00 194

转载 使用JOTM实现分布式事务管理(多数据源)

使用spring和hibernate可以很方便的实现一个数据源的事务管理,但是如果需要同时对多个数据源进行事务控制,并且不想使用重量级容器提供的机制的话,可以使用JOTM达到目的.JOTM的配置十分简单,spring已经内置了对JOTM的支持,一.<bean id="jotm" class="org.springframework...

2017-12-28 17:24:00 106

转载 分布式系统事务一致性解决方案(转)

本文首发于InfoQ,版权所有,请勿转载!!!http://www.infoq.com/cn/articles/solution-of-distributed-system-transaction-consistency开篇在OLTP系统领域,我们在很多业务场景下都会面临事务一致性方面的需求,例如最经典的Bob给Smith转账的案例。传统的企业开发,系统往往是以单体应用形式存在的,...

2017-12-28 17:21:00 78

转载 SpringMVC,Mybatis,FreeMarker连接mycat示例(一)

首页 > 程序开发 > 软件开发 > Java > 正文 SpringMVC,Mybatis,FreeMarker连接mycat示例(一) ...

2017-12-28 16:59:00 220

转载 从零开发分布式数据库中间件 二、构建MyBatis的读写分离数据库中间件

从零开发分布式数据库中间件 二、构建MyBatis的读写分离数据库中间件 在上一节 从零开发分布式数据库中间件 ...

2017-12-28 16:29:00 72

转载 从零开发分布式数据库中间件 一、读写分离的数据库中间件(转)

从零开发分布式数据库中间件 一、读写分离的数据库中间件 ...

2017-12-28 16:25:00 103

转载 mycat基本概念及读写分离一

mycat基本概念及读写分离一 目录(?)[+]安装与启动mycat目录介绍mycat三个最重要配置文件验证读写分离安装与启动l...

2017-12-28 16:07:00 124

转载 MyCAT简易入门

MyCAT是mysql中间件,前身是阿里大名鼎鼎的Cobar,Cobar在开源了一段时间后,不了了之。于是MyCAT扛起了这面大旗,在大数据时代,其重要性愈发彰显。这篇文章主要是MyCAT的入门部署。一、安装java因Mycat是用java开发的,所以需要在实验环境下安装java,官方建议jdk1.7及以上版本Java Oracle官方下载地址为:http://www.oracl...

2017-12-28 15:18:00 103

转载 mycat 不得不说的缘分(转)

1,愕然回首,它在灯火阑珊处关于mysql集群中间件,以前写在应用程序里面,由开发人员实现,在配置文件里面写多个数据源,写库一个数据源,读库一个数据源,笨拙不高效,由于程序员的差异化,效果并不是特别理想。后来,组织了开发人员写了一个自动识别读写的功能模块接口,让开发人员调...

2017-12-28 14:42:00 90

转载 如何在win10上同时安装python2和python3

哎,其实本人已经用惯了python2,听说python3的语法有很多不一样的地方,那我之前写的算法改起来岂不是日了狗了吗?所以一直没改用python3。但是谷歌的那个TensorFlow,在windows下只能支持python3,没办法,这时候我就决定在我的电脑里同时装python2和python3,看看是否可行。首先,我们去官网,找到对应的安装包!python3的如下:版本是3...

2017-12-28 14:24:00 56

转载 SQL优化工具SQLAdvisor使用(转)

一、简介在数据库运维过程中,优化SQL是业务团队与DBA团队的日常任务。例行SQL优化,不仅可以提升程序性能,还能够降低线上故障的概率。目前常用的SQL优化方式包括但不限于:业务层优化、SQL逻辑优化、索引优化等。其中索引优化通常通过调整索引或新增索引从而达到SQL优化的目的。索引优化往往可以在短时间内产生非常巨大的效果。如果能够将索引优化转化成工具化、标准...

2017-12-28 14:08:00 606

转载 Ubuntu 美团sql优化工具SQLAdvisor的安装(转)

by2009 ...

2017-12-28 10:45:00 207

转载 mapper提示Could not autowire. No beans of … type found?

工具及背景: IntelliJ IDEA 2016.1.3 Ultimate。spring boot, maven项目,利用mybatis 注解的方式查询mysql在自动生成工具生成代码后,service层调用Dao层出现了这样一个错误;检查mapper文件和配置文件等都没问题;如何解决这一问题呢? 加@Repository第二种解决方法:我在IDEA中安装了【iBATIS/MyB...

2017-12-27 17:43:00 503

转载 aop 中joinpoint的使用方法

一.簡述下joinpoint在不同情況下的不同:1.在around中可以用,此時可以執行被包裹的代碼,可以根據情況來判斷是否執行被包裹的代碼,以實現控制的作用。[java] view plain copy print?publicvoidaround(ProceedingJoinPointjoinpoint){...

2017-12-27 16:57:00 2669

转载 JAVA中的反射机制

反射,当时经常听他们说,自己也看过一些资料,也可能在设计模式中使用过,但是感觉对它没有一个较深入的了解,这次重新学习了一下,感觉还行吧! 一,先看一下反射的概念:主要是指程序可以访问,检测和修改它本身状态或行为的一种能力,并能根据自身行为的状态和结果,调整或修改...

2017-12-27 16:48:00 70

转载 Java反射之getInterfaces()方法

今天学习Spring3框架,在理解模拟实现Spring Ioc容器的时候遇到了getInterfaces()方法。getInterfaces()方法和Java的反射机制有关。它能够获得这个对象所实现的接口。例如:Class<?> string01 = person.getClass().getInterfaces()[0...

2017-12-27 16:46:00 231

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除